  • Patent number: 10923329
    Abstract: An apparatus for processing reaction products that are deposited when an etching target film contained in a target object to be processed is etched is provided with: a processing chamber; a partition plate; a plasma source; a mounting table; a first processing gas supply unit; a second processing gas supply unit. The processing chamber defines a space, and the partition plate is arranged within the processing chamber and divides the space into a plasma generating space and a substrate processing space, while suppressing permeation of ions and vacuum ultraviolet rays. The plasma source generates a plasma in the plasma forming space. The mounting table is arranged in the substrate processing space to mount the target object thereon.

  • Patent number: 10825688
    Abstract: A method MT in an embodiment is a method for etching an etching target layer EL which is included in a wafer W and contains copper. The wafer W includes the etching target layer EL, and a mask MK provided on the etching target layer EL. In the method MT, the etching target layer EL is etched by repeatedly executing a sequence SQ including a first step of generating a plasma of a first gas in a processing container 12 of a plasma processing apparatus 10 in which the wafer W is accommodated, a second step of generating a plasma of a second gas in the processing container 12, and a third step of generating a plasma of a third gas in the processing container 12. The first gas contains a hydrocarbon gas, the second gas contains either a rare gas or a mixed gas of a rare gas and hydrogen gas, and the third gas contains hydrogen gas.

  • Patent number: 9660182
    Abstract: A plasma processing method of etching a multilayered material having a structure where a first magnetic layer 105 and a second magnetic layer 103 are stacked with an insulating layer 104 therebetween is performed by a plasma processing apparatus 10 including a processing chamber 12 where a processing space S is formed; and a gas supply unit 44 of supplying a processing gas into the processing space, and includes a first etching process where the first magnetic layer is etched by supplying a first processing gas and generating plasma, and the first etching process is stopped on a surface of the insulating layer; and a second etching process where a residue Z is removed by supplying a second processing gas and generating plasma. The first magnetic layer and the second magnetic layer contain CoFeB, the first processing gas contains Cl2, and the second processing gas contains H2.
